The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

- silviop15
I must admit, I am surprised such a rare prototype is not at the NACM or Fort Lee.


There has never been rhyme or reason into why a particular vehicle is where it is. The oldest existing M-3 Grant sitting outside a VFW in Newark DE, a T95 prototype sitting in a local memorial park in Weirton WV. Often it seems to be where ever the vehicle was located when the army no longer needed it or what vehicle was available when a request came in for a display vehicle
